Why Businesses That Use Vehicles Need Commercial Transport Insurance

Most people automatically associate commercial vehicles with trucks and vans, as these are the vehicles that are commonly branded by company names. As a result, some business owners will simply take out auto insurance for their company car, yet this does not provide you with the same degree of protection that commercial transport insurance does. The first thing that you should keep in mind is that vans and trucks are not the only modes of commercial transportation. Secondly, even if you have track insurance or auto insurance commercial insurance is still critical for your business. Read on for a few reasons why every business that makes use of vehicles needs commercial transport insurance.

Commercial auto insurance will cover any type of automobile

Businesses that rely on vehicles for their daily operations should invest in commercial auto insurance coverage because this type of policy is applicable for any car that you use for your operations. Whether you make use of SUVs, sedans, or even limousines, this auto insurance will make sure that it is covered as long as it was being employed for business purposes when it got into an accident, was vandalized, was stolen, and so on. You should be cognizant of the fact, though, that these vehicles need to be registered under your company name.

Commercial auto insurance will cover an array of valuables

There is a multitude of ways that you could be making use of your company vehicles at any given time. For instance, if you own a service delivery business then your employees will use these vehicles to get to the different locations they need to be. If, for example, you specialize in massages and one of the workers was to get into an accident that damaged the massage bed in the vehicle, commercial auto insurance will compensate you for this loss. Alternately, you could be running an HVAC business. As such, your technicians need to visit multiple homes in a day. If they are transporting an air conditioning system to install at a customer's home, but it is stolen from the vehicle, your commercial auto insurance may cover this loss.

Commercial auto insurance will safeguard your employees

You may have the most conscientious individuals driving your fleet of commercial vehicles, but you can never anticipate a car accident. If one of your employees was to be involved in a collision and get seriously hurt, the company's commercial auto insurance will take care of the associated medical expenses. However, if your employee was driving this car on personal errands rather than for business smatters, the medical costs will have to be taken care of out of pocket.
